The arrows indicate the linkages cleaved bymicrococcal DNase and calf spleen phosphodiesterase, yielding a digest composedexclu- WebA stable deoxyribonucleic acid (DNA) polymerase (EC 2.7.7.7) with a temperature optimum of 80 degrees C has been purified from the extreme thermophile Thermus aquaticus. DNA is a long, double-stranded, helical molecule composed of building blocks called deoxyribonucleotides. Each deoxyribonucleotide is composed of three parts: a molecule of the 5-carbon sugar deoxyribose, a nitrogenous base, and a phosphate group (Figure 19.3. 1 ).
